# Searchlight relevance tuning — env notes
# Maintainers: keep this block current.
# BM25 weights below were tuned against the Quellmark corpus, March run.
# Do not bump FIELD_BOOST_TITLE past 4.0; recall craters.
# SYNONYM_PACK=regional-v2 is required for the Torbay index.
# Re-run eval harness after any change and paste scores in the tuning log.
# The relevance service also needs its ranking-API credential, which goes on the next line.

sealed setting: ARCHIVE_KEY3=8d0

**Q: Why did the payroll export switch from fixed-width to delimited?**

Short version: our downstream processor (Grindelle) dropped fixed-width support, so the Septal exporter now emits pipe-delimited files with a versioned header row. When reviewing, check that column order matches the v3 spec and that currency fields keep two decimals — rounding drift bit us last quarter. Edge cases (mid-cycle hires, retro adjustments) are documented with examples on the internal spec page.

runbook for badug-kadup: https://confluence.zemvarlabs.internal/projects/browse/display/projects/bd1b

Build agents in the Corvasse fleet drift up to four seconds apart. Plugin authors must not compare timestamps across agents; use the coordinator's monotonic sequence numbers instead. Signed artifacts tolerate 30 seconds of skew, after which verification fails hard. Do not retry on skew errors — file a fleet ticket. To query the time-sync diagnostics endpoint, authenticate against the internal Hallmere service with the key below.

app token of tawip-kahap = kto2_v5

## Crashline pipeline — default changes

For this week's sync: the crash-report pipeline now samples non-fatal errors at a lower rate by default and symbolication retries were raised from two to five. Stale reports older than thirty days are auto-purged. No action needed from app teams. The pipeline's new default configuration follows.

service settings:
[norax]
team = zormir
access_code = ac_c302d9
owner = ralmir.zorox
host = norax.zarqeltech.internal
port = 11211
peer = praion.halixlabs.example
salt = 9c2a54f3
pin = 9824

Step 2 — Deploying PickPath to staging

Welcome aboard! Once your build of the PickPath optimizer passes the route tests, you'll push it through the Corvex release tool. It refuses anything unsigned, so set up your signer first — takes about a minute. Drop the following deploy key into your local config.

release key, hadug-kawef: bky13_mPGeFZeR1GZ1G